SIMPSON, Edna Oakes, (wife of Sidney E. Simpson), a Representative from Illinois; born in Carrollton, Greene County, Ill., October 26, 1891; elected as a Republican to the Eighty-sixth Congress (January 3, 1959-January 3, 1961); did not seek renomination in 1960; was a resident of Carrollton, Ill., until her death in Alton, Ill., on May 15, 1984.
